Fort Lauderdale (zip 33312) has an unemployment rate of 6.1%. The US average is 6.0%.

Fort Lauderdale (zip 33312) has seen the job market increase by 1.9% over the last year.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 37.9%, which is higher than the US average of 33.5%.

Tax Rates for Fort Lauderdale (zip 33312)
- The Sales Tax Rate for Fort Lauderdale (zip 33312) is 6.0%. The US average is 7.3%.
- The Income Tax Rate for Fort Lauderdale (zip 33312) is 0.0%. The US average is 4.6%.
- Tax Rates can have a big impact when Comparing Cost of Living.

Income and Salaries for Fort Lauderdale (zip 33312)
- The average income of a Fort Lauderdale (zip 33312) resident is $25,169 a year. The US average is $28,555 a year.
- The Median household income of a Fort Lauderdale (zip 33312) resident is $63,240 a year. The US average is $69,021 a year.
